Seeger, former CIA SIS Greenwich Mean Time or “GMT” is an internationally accepted timing standard by which all other time zones are defined. A GMT watch tracks one or two additional time zones by way of a fourth hand, a bezel or chapter ring with 24-hour markings, or some combination of the two. Revered by enthusiasts for invoking a sense of nostalgia, GMT watches serve as a throwback to the golden age of travel before cell phones. But for those at the tip of the spear living in Zulu Time, the GMT has a more practical function. Living In Zulu Time While there were earlier attempts at tracking multiple timezones, like the watches US Navy officer Philip Van Horn Weems developed with Longines in the ‘20s, GMT watches as we know them today took off in the 1950s, first with the Glycine Airman in 1953 and followed by the Rolex GMT-Master in 1954. Robust and relatively attainable at the time, this burgeoning category of watches provided the ability to ascertain the time of day in two or even three time zones around the globe at a glance. The Tudor Black Bay GMT (Photo Credit: James Rupley) For pilots or the then-novel community of international business travelers, watches like the GMT-Master were exceptionally helpful. But why are GMT watches important to the world of Watches of Espionage? In The Shadow World - Timing Is Everything We regularly point out that time is an essential factor in both espionage and special operations, sometimes acting as the difference between life and death if a case officer or agent is not at a given meeting place precisely on time. Lingering on “the X” invites scrutiny and, in the shadowy world of espionage, scrutiny can mean arrest, prison, or even execution. Special operations missions are also exceptionally choreographed, meaning every second counts when a team is linking up on the ground, at sea, or in the air. And this is where a GMT watch serves as an essential piece of kit. Rolex GMT Master Reference 1675 on Billy Waugh’s wrist in retirement. Waugh was a legendary Special Forces operator and CIA contractor. (Photo Credit, Recoil Magazine and Tom Marshall) This level of choreography across assets often involves traveling across multiple time zones. Coordinating a multifaceted mission based on various local timing standards invites uncertainty and risk, with the entire concept of local time potentially meaning different things to different people for any number of different units or assets involved. This is why case officers and special ops personnel live in what is known as Zulu Time. Being on Zulu Time ensures everyone is on time and minimizes the risk of operations failing due to timing errors. Utilized by the military, various government organizations, and the world of aviation, Zulu Time is so named for the Z timezone in the ACP 121 military timing standard of 25 letter-designated zones, with each zone referring to a longitudinal swath of the Earth. As you may have surmised, the Z, pronounced “Zulu” in NATO’s phonetic alphabet, indicates Greenwich Mean Time or GMT, which is also often referred to as UTC or Coordinated Universal Time. If everyone involved in a given mission is working in Zulu Time, no matter where they are in the world, everyone is on the same page. If your watch happens to display Zulu Time in addition to local time, all the better. Vintage Bulova advertisement for the Accutron Astronaut. The 1960s & 1970s: Traveling At The Edge Of Space In Zulu Time The most celebrated story in the history of GMT watches is the legendary affiliation between Pan American Airlines, the Boeing 707, and the aforementioned GMT-Master. While the pages of that story are well-worn, several other GMT watches deserve their place in history especially when being viewed through the lens of our community. In the late 1950s, the CIA and Lockheed’s Skunk Works were working on the Archangel program to produce a manned, aerial reconnaissance aircraft. That program produced the A-12, an aircraft that would fly at the edge of space at speeds greater than 2000 mph. Given the incredible speed, every piece of the aircraft, the cameras, the film, and even the pressure suits for the pilots had to be redesigned to handle the rigors of the mission. Lockheed’s A-12 Reconnaissance Aircraft Neither Lockheed nor the CIA were certain what would happen to a standard mechanical watch at the edge of space with the incredible g-forces caused by accelerating to such high speeds. At the same time, the Agency needed their pilots to have a watch that would track both local time at their base as well as Zulu Time, the basis for all of their communications. W.O.E.s Personal Vintage Bulova, Accutron (Photo Credit: James Rupley) Rather than a Glycine or a Rolex GMT-Master, both of which were popular with more conventional pilots of the day, early A-12 pilots were issued a Bulova Accutron Astronaut equipped with a GMT-hand as well as a friction-fit 24-hour bezel. At the A-12’s incredible speeds, a pilot traveled through various time zones in minutes, making the ability to easily track Zulu Time with their watch essential for coordinating and communicating with ground crews and higher levels of operational oversight. 1990-1991: Fighting A War In Two Time Zones In addition to the necessity of Zulu Time, there are examples of managing two critical time zones with two separate watches. Nearly every photo of General Norman Schwarzkopf, Commander of the United States Central Command (CENTCOM) during the First Gulf War, shows the general wearing two watches. In a previous Dispatch, Stormin’ Norman explained that he needed to track the time in both Saudi Arabia and Washington, DC, balancing the needs of the Joint Chiefs, the Secretary of Defense, and the President, all of whom were operating on Eastern Standard Time (EST), with troops on the ground operating on Arabian Standard Time (AST). Why the general opted for a pair of Seiko watches as opposed to any number of GMT watches available in the early 1990s is anyone’s guess, but it’s possible the general simply found two watches to be the easier, or perhaps more attainable, option. CIA’s Team Alpha prior to Insertion into Afghanistan. Seeger Back Row, Third From Left. (Photo Credit: CIA) 2001: The Global War On Terror Fast forward to 2001 and post-9/11 conflicts in Southwest Asia and the Middle East. When I deployed to Afghanistan as a team leader of one of the CIA’s first teams to enter the country, the most common watches on the wrists of most Special Forces operators and specifically on my team were plastic digital watches from brands like G-Shock and Timex. While not often considered among the GMT category, these straightforward digital tool watches (D.T.W.) displayed a single time zone with another one available at the push of a button. What was the second time zone? Zulu Time or UTC was the most common option. Given the amount of military and government assets in the country at the time, Zulu Time was essential for coordinating complex operations in theater. When a Special Forces ODA in Afghanistan requested logistics support from TF Dagger at Karshi-Khanabad airfield in Southern Uzbekistan (with a half-hour time difference from Afghanistan) or close air support aka “steel on target” from a USAF aircraft based outside the theater or a US Navy fast mover from a carrier battle group in the Arabian Sea, all of the players could be working off of the same time “hack.” Similarly, when my team communicated with CIA headquarters, our satellite communication – whether data or voice – was keyed to Zulu Time so that all of the participants knew when that vital communication would take place. A trio of Rolex GMT Master II models. (Photo Credit: James Rupley) Today: An Abundance Of Choices While digital watches are exceptionally robust and in many cases offer convenient features such as solar charging, many do not provide an at-a-glance view of two time zones. Looking to the world of analog quartz and mechanical timekeeping, there are a number of options available today for GMT enthusiasts whether managing Zulu Time is at the top of your list of priorities or not. Starting with the most basic, certain watches including the Benrus Type I and II of the 1970s utilized a simple time-only movement and display in conjunction with a rotating bezel with 12-hour markings. By rotating the bezel to reflect a given time difference, an operator could relatively easily track another timezone including Zulu Time. Using a time-only caliber, the Mil-Spec Benrus Type I provided a measure of GMT functionality using nothing more than a rotating 12-hour bezel. (Photo Credit: Analog Shift) By a wide margin, the most common format for an analog GMT leans into a fourth hand used in coordination with either a chapter ring or bezel equipped with 24-hour markings. In many ways cemented by the GMT-Master and its modern descendant the GMT-Master II, which is still making its way beyond the boundaries of the Earth’s atmosphere on the wrist of a certain Saudi astronaut, the format can now be found in both quartz and automatic watches at a wide variety of price points. Though technology has drastically improved our operational capabilities when working across time zones, a straightforward and robust GMT watch still serves as a useful tool in any modern operator or case officer’s arsenal. Read On79 years ago the most important Allied coordinated effort of WWII took place. These watches kept soldiers on time. On Tuesday June 6th, 1944 the largest seaborne invasion in history occurred. Nearly 160,000 allied troops managed to change the course of WWII by storming the beaches of Normandy and setting off the liberation of France from the Nazis, and later, a victory. The invasion began at 6:30am, when soldiers started storming five beaches–Omaha, Utah, Gold, Sword, Juno. Approximately 11,000 aircraft and 7,000 watercraft supported the invasion. Shortly before the landing, under the cover of darkness, Paratroopers, including commandos from the Office of Strategic Services (OSS), were inserted into strategic spots inland in order to weaken the German defense network and provide a strategic advantage to the soldiers arriving by amphibious craft. Operation Overlord, June 6, 1944 Today marks the 79th anniversary of the day this incredible effort took place. Roughly 73,000 Allied soldiers were lost over the course of the invasion. “D-Day” as its known, typically refers to these Normandy landings, but in the larger military context, it refers to the exact time a combat action takes place. D-Day and H-Hour refer to the day an hour a coordinated effort is initiated. “D-Day”, in the case of the Normandy Invasion, was actually set for June 5th, but General Eisenhower made the choice to delay the attack due to rough seas and inclement weather. General Eisenhower reportedly wore a Heuer Chronograph, as identified by @niccoloy (Government Archives) In war, time matters. A massive concerted effort between Allied nations meant every single soldier had to be on time and operating in unison. The tool that helped orchestrate an invasion that shifted the outcome of the war? The humble wristwatch. In the 1940s, watches were hardly considered as the luxury accessories they are today. Soldiers wore watches that were issued to them as a part of the set of tools needed to do a very important job. Photo Credit: Vertex Watches History buffs, WWII enthusiasts, and even re-enactors pay incredible attention to details surrounding WWII, but somehow one of the most important pieces of kit–the watch–is often overlooked. At W.O.E. we care about nothing but details, so today, on the anniversary of D-Day, we’ll take a look at some of the watches that were on the wrists of soldiers, sailors, and airmen that were involved in the invasion. The A-11 (produced by Bulova, Elgin, Waltham and others) Personal collection of former CIA Officer and W.O.E. contributor, J.R. Seeger. Commonly referred to as “the watch that won the war”, the A-11 was the most ubiquitous service watch during WWII. It’s a specification, rather than an actual watch, and that meant that various companies could produce watches to this spec and in turn, the government would purchase these watches and distribute them to service personnel. For its time, the specification set was exacting, the watch needed a black dial with white numerical indices, a manual-winding, hacking movement with center seconds, 10 minute markers, an hour and minute hand. The case came in at a compact 32 millimeters. The watches saw service with the Brits as well as the Americans. The Army Ordnance Watch Army Time Piece (ATP) watch of the UK forces and the US Army Ordnance (ORD) on original OSS manual (Seeger’s personal collection) While the A-11 was rated for aviation operations (and specific maritime operations), the “ORD” watches were general-purpose watches issued to US soldiers en masse. The specification outlined in the TM 9-1575 War Department Technical Manual for Wrist Watches, Pocket Watches, Stop Watches allows for some variation in design, so Waltham, Hamilton, Bulova and Elgin all put their own twist on these watches meant to be mass produced for soldiers. These watches are distinguished by their white dials and “Ord Dept” engravings on the caseback. The “Dirty Dozen” MoD Watches The Dirty Dozen - all twelve W.W.W. watches (Credit: A Collected Man) Most popular among collectors is a series of 12 watches produced by the likes of Buren, Cyma, Eterna, Grana, Jaeger-LeCoultre, Lemania, Longines, IWC, Omega, Record, Timor, and Vertex. On all of these British-issued watches you’ll find W.W.W. (Watch, Wrist, Waterproof) and a broadarrow insignia engraved in the back. It’s unknown how many of each were produced because it’s believed that only WC, JLC, and Omega recorded their production at 6,000, 10,000, and 25,000 respectively. The Dirty Dozen were general service watches, and that meant they saw service with various service roles across all functions of the military. While these pieces were not delivered until after D-Day at the conclusion of the war, they are a product of this conflict. IWC Dirty Dozen piece with original box (Credit: A Collected Man) We tend to romanticize the equipment used by service members carrying out brave efforts that changed the course of world history. Watches are certainly among the kind of things we tend to prescribe a certain importance to–and that’s not to be ignored, timekeeping is absolutely vital especially when it comes to a massive coordination such as Operation Overlord. But watches only supported the mission as a piece of gear with an assigned function. They were, and always will be, tools to get the job done. CIA Case Officer: The Ideal Timepiece by J.R. Seeger When I joined the CIA in the 1980s, my supervisors all served in Southeast Asia during the ‘60s and ’70s. Almost all men and they wore what might have been considered a “headquarters uniform:” short sleeved white or blue oxford shirts, ties always loose at the throat, and khaki pants. On one wrist was a gold chain known as a baht chain because each link was of a certain value in the Thai currency. On the other wrist was a Rolex watch. Usually, the watches were Rolex GMT Masters or Rolex Datejust watches. No Rolex or other Mil-Spec watches for them. They did not need to pretend to be commandos. They were commandos. Vintage Rolex sign, Tawila District in Aden, Yemen (Photo Credit: Unknown) I had just left the Army and had a Bulova watch given to me by my mother when I graduated from high school over a dozen years earlier. By the early 1980s, a Rolex – any Rolex – was more than a two month’s salary and I wasn’t about to spend that sort of money on a tool when my Bulova still worked well and my backup watch, a Casio digital watch, was under $50. The Swiss tool watch train had left the station and I was still on the platform. I have previously written about my experience with watches as tools in the Afghan war-zone. Black acrylic watches, accurate quartz watches, were my choice. Twenty years later, when we talk about watches for the field, we are looking at a world where Case Officers (C/Os) are less likely to be in forward operating bases in warzones. They are more likely to work in traditional postings in major cities around the world. It is a different environment and it calls for a different sort of kit. When we are talking about “watches for the field,” we are not using the term in the same way that most watch companies might. After all, the CIA Case Officer in the field is going to face challenges that are not consistent with a mountain climber, a yacht racer, a member of the armed forces, or a first responder (i.e. police officer, fire fighter, or EMT). That doesn’t mean that a “field watch” used by one of these avocations and professions won’t work with Case Officer tradecraft. It just means that there are other, different requirements. Seeger and General Dostum on the night of insertion in Afghanistan, 16 October 2001, Casio F-91W on Seeger’s wrist. (Photo Credit: Seeger) So, what are the basic requirements for a CIA field watch? The watch must be reliable. That means it must work all the time, every time; The watch must be easy to read at a glance; The watch must be readable in the dark either through luminous hands or a LED backlight; The watch must be rugged enough to withstand dust, water, and shock. Arabic Seiko (Photo Credit: James Rupley) Here is where the requirements shift when shopping for a C/O: The watch must be low profile. A C/O walking on the streets with an expensive Swiss or Japanese watch is a target for criminals and, just as important, easy to spot by surveillance. Expensive and/or out of place items – sports cars, watches, shoes, clothes, a bag – make it easy for surveillance to spot their target and keep on their target. On the street, a C/O must disappear into the crowd. Just as a fine European sports car is not appropriate for a C/O in the field, a large, polished dive watch on a steel bracelet stands out and gives surveillance another point of reference when they are tracking a C/O; As a corollary to the above point, the watch must be consistent with the C/O’s cover. A C/O must be able to transition quickly from cover duty to clandestine work. While there may be time to go home and change, it isn’t as if the C/O on the street can assume an entirely different persona (an outfit more suited to a Special Operations night raid for example). Therefore, a large PVD or black acrylic watch that can withstand over 20 ATMs underwater and has tritium luminous markers is unlikely to be a good choice unless the C/O’s cover supports that sort of watch; The watch must not be a “connected” watch. If your watch helps you connect to the outside world through Bluetooth or directly through a wireless signal of any sort, it also means your watch can be used by an adversary to track you. A few years ago, US military force protection studies demonstrated that fitness tracker smart watches could be used by an adversary to determine precisely where an individual serviceman was and, then by extension, where his unit was in the field. Smart watches are off limits to case officers because case officers never want to help adversaries track them. A map of activity in Djibouti. “A map of fitness-tracker data may have compromised top-secret US military bases around the world” (Source: Business Insider) What are the options for a C/O who doesn’t have a large, personal budget but needs a watch that fits in all the parts of his/her life? Among my colleagues, I am a notorious cheapskate, so I’m offering the following choices for under $1000. Please note: We have experience with most if not all of these watches, but none of the companies involved have any commercial links to W.O.E. At the lowest end of the spectrum are Casio, Timex and Seiko watches. These companies all make inexpensive, rugged watches. Some of the higher end Casio G-shocks and Timex Ironman watches are monsters on the wrist and probably not ideal for a C/O. That said, a 5610 Solar G-shock, a Timex Expedition or even the smaller Ironman watches, or any selection from the Seiko 5 collection are all good choices for well under $200. There may have been a time when a black acrylic watch was not acceptable for daily business wear. That time is long passed; (Photo Credit: James Rupley) At the mid-range ($200-600), the choices expand exponentially. There are American Assembled watches, European and Japanese models that all work in this category. Most are “dress tool” watches that have over 10ATM or more of water resistance, sapphire crystals and reliable movements. At this price point, it is possible to find US firms such as Vaer, Shinola, Sangin or Cincinnati Watch company, Japanese firms Seiko, Orient, Citizen or Bulova, and Swiss firms like Davosa and Tissot. Other European watch companies including the French firm Wolbrook and the German firm LACO also make watches that fit the requirements. All pass the C/O test of looking like a watch a “normal” person might wear but still provide reliability, ruggedness and good visibility during night work; Sangin Overlord and W.O.E. numbered coin (J.R. Seeger) When you approach $1000, the c/o crosses the threshold from tool to luxury tool watch. Formerly a US company and now part of the Swatch Group, Hamilton Khaki line– especially when paired with a leather strap or steel bracelet are hard to beat for the blend of day work wear and night street operations. Seiko has their own options with the Seiko Alpinist and other sport watches in the Prospex line. And, once again Tissot watches at this price range answer all of the requirements. Seiko Alpinist (Seiko) Conclusion: There are dozens of other watches out there that a C/O can use in the field. Most Case Officers answer direct questions with two words: It depends. That is because every human is different and what is ideal for one person is useless for another. Some will want quartz watches for the “set it and forget it” nature of the watch. Others will want a mechanical watch that requires slightly more care in setting the time but does not rely on a battery. C/O work is not about gunfights, explosions, or car chases (leave that image for our favorite thrillers), but that doesn’t mean a case officer’s watch isn’t an essential piece of kit. Time is everything for a Case Officer and a watch is what keeps a C/O on time. Read Next: Ask Watches Of Espionage Anything J.R. Seeger's personal watch collection and memorabilia. J.R. Read OnIn 1957 Clarence “Kelly” Johnson, the leader of aircraft manufacturer Lockheed’s Advanced Development program dubbed Skunk Works, knew satellites would make reconnaissance aircraft obsolete in the near future. It was determined that the U-2 spy plane, which Johnson had worked on, had a radar cross section that was simply too large to operate completely undetected. Three years later one flown by pilot Gary Powers would be shot down in Soviet Airspace and he would be captured and charged with espionage. The price of human life was simply too high to pay, and with the Cold War in full swing, US intelligence-gathering operations were necessary to keep an edge over the nuclear-capable Soviets. This meant that significant investments were being made in satellite technology to solve these problems, but the technology wasn’t quite where it needed to be just yet. That day would come, but the impending obsolescence of aircraft built for reconnaissance didn’t stop Johnson from spearheading one last effort: Project Oxcart. Richard Bissell was the CIA officer responsible for facilitating the successor to the U-2. He oversaw Project Gusto, which was a committee set up to explore all possible solutions to the dynamic need for a next-generation aerial reconnaissance platform. Lockheed’s submission won out over Convair’s designs derived from the B-58 Hustler, and the A-12 project was funded and kicked off. The A-12 had its maiden flight on April 25th, 1962, and subsequently carried out 2,850 test flights before its first official mission on May 31st, 1967. Ironically, the A-12 never carried out any overflights of the Soviet Union or Cuba, which is exactly what it was intended for. The CIA found another use for the plane: to spy on North Vietnam. Departing from Kadena Air Base in Japan, the A-12 performed 22 sorties gathering intelligence on the movements of North Vietnamese forces. The project wasn’t all for naught, however. The development of the A-12 led to the creation of the SR-71, the often-celebrated and easily recognizable icon that’s wrongly dubbed “the fastest airplane ever to have graced our skies” even though that honor officially belongs to the A-12 at just over Mach 3.3. While the A-12 was born and died in secrecy being owned and operated by the CIA, the SR-71 was the product of the USAF. Both carried out surveillance overflights, but the SR-71 was fit for a wider range of missions, not to mention a two-seat configuration for a reconnaissance officer. The plane featured a modular system in the nose-mounted equipment bay that allowed for ELINT and SLR data to be collected. ELINT is electronic intelligence, while SLR is side-looking radar, and the added benefit of gathering additional intelligence meant that the SR-71 had a much longer service life and participated in just about every single conflict up until 1989, until they were retired. The A-12 on display at CIA Headquarters — number eight in production of the 15 A-12s built — was the first of the operational fleet to be certified for Mach 3. No piloted operational jet aircraft has ever flown faster or higher. (Photo Credit: CIA) And that’s why it has become perhaps the most prominent military aircraft ever produced. It’s become a symbol for superlative, next-generation technology and a very specific can-do attitude of the mid-century era that simply doesn’t exist anymore. Budgets be damned, the Blackbird was going to be the most capable airplane ever. And it was. It’s a flying superlative. However, the watch that’s most typically associated with the A-12 is anything but iconic, instead it’s been relegated to enjoyment by a very niche community of die-hards. Although what it lacks in popularity it more than makes up for in technical prowess. The Bulova Astronaut was a perfect horological fit for the A-12; both platforms were so far ahead of their time that neither of the core technologies they introduced stuck around long after they were gone. The Astronaut used the Accutron tuning fork movement, which predated quartz and proved to be accurate to one second a month. It didn’t have a balance assembly (or mainspring), instead it used a tuning fork oscillator that vibrated at 360hz. If we think in terms of a “propulsion system,” the tuning fork movement was congruent to the SR-71’s J58 engine that pioneered a system that essentially turned it from a standard jet engine at lower speed to a ramjet engine above Mach 2. Bulova Accutron Astronaut, late 1960s (W.O.E.s Personal Collection) Both the tuning fork mechanism and the J58 were engineering marvels that excelled at capturing and controlling energy and bending it to humankind’s will. The Bulova Accutron Astronaut even emits a high-pitch whine that’s straight out of a sci-fi movie. The advantage of the tuning fork movement for an A-12 pilot is that there isn’t a balance spring that G forces would be able to affect, and in an airplane that can go over Mach 3, G forces are a crucial concern for a mechanical watch. Accutron movements proved effective and reliable for most of NASA’s cockpit instrumentation in the Gemini rockets, and later, the Apollo program. The CIA supplied the A-12 pilots with the Bulova and when the program ended, the watches stayed with the pilots. Vintage Watch Advertisement, 1969 (W.O.E.s Personal Collection) In typical CIA fashion, the Agency cared nothing about the absolute technical and engineering achievement of both the A-12 and the Bulova Astronaut. They were tools to get the mission done. If there was a cheaper or more effective tool available to execute the mission, those would be chosen, and eventually, they were. Quartz watches replaced the tuning fork movement, and more conventional propulsion systems were favored over the complex retracting inlet cone system that allowed Mach 3+ flight on the Blackbird. The existence and disappearance of both these technical marvels serves as a reminder that no matter how much we romanticize or idolize incredible technology, it’s all in service of a larger mission: Giving America a competitive advantage when it comes to national security.
